Time and Stress Management

One of the most significant benefits of property management for real estate investors is the time and stress it saves. Property managers handle a wide range of responsibilities that consume a significant amount of time and effort. These tasks include tenant screening, rent collection, and handling maintenance requests. By delegating these responsibilities to a property manager, investors can free up their time to focus on other aspects of their investments or simply enjoy personal time without the stress of managing properties.

A property manager's expertise in tenant screening is particularly valuable. They have the experience and resources to thoroughly vet potential tenants, ensuring that only reliable and responsible individuals occupy the rental properties. This reduces the chances of dealing with problematic tenants, late rent payments, or eviction proceedings, saving investors from potential headaches.

Maximising Rental Income

Another significant advantage of hiring a property manager is their ability to maximise rental income for investors. Property managers have a deep understanding of the local real estate market and can set appropriate rental rates based on factors such as location, property condition, and amenities. They also keep a close eye on market trends and adjust rental rates accordingly to ensure that investors are getting the most out of their investment properties.

In addition to setting rental rates, property managers also excel at minimising vacancy periods. They employ various marketing strategies to attract potential tenants and ensure that properties are leased quickly. This reduces the time during which the property is unoccupied, resulting in higher rental income for the investor.

Tenant Retention

Keeping good tenants is crucial for real estate investors, as turnover can be costly and time-consuming. This is where property managers play a vital role. They ensure tenant satisfaction by promptly addressing concerns and handling repair requests. By providing excellent customer service, property managers foster healthy relationships with tenants, increasing the likelihood of lease renewals.

Regular property inspections are another essential aspect of tenant retention. Property managers conduct routine inspections to identify any maintenance issues and address them promptly. This proactive approach not only keeps tenants happy but also helps maintain the property's condition, saving investors from costly repairs down the line.

Legal Compliance

Navigating the complex web of local laws and regulations can be a daunting task for real estate investors. Property managers bring extensive knowledge and experience in this area, ensuring that investors remain compliant with all legal requirements. From fair housing practices to health and safety codes, property managers ensure that investors are adhering to all applicable laws.

Eviction procedures are another area where property managers prove invaluable. They are well-versed in the proper legal steps required for eviction, reducing the risk of costly legal battles for investors. By having professional support, investors can rest assured that their rental properties are being managed within the bounds of the law, minimising legal risks.

Maintenance and Repairs

Maintenance and repairs are an inevitable part of owning rental properties. Property managers have a vast network of reliable contractors, ensuring that repairs are handled promptly and efficiently. This saves investors the hassle of searching for contractors themselves and dealing with the logistics of scheduling repairs.

Moreover, property managers emphasise preventative maintenance measures. They conduct regular inspections and address minor issues before they escalate into major problems. This proactive approach not only saves investors money on expensive repairs but also helps maintain the value of the property.
